Differences in Inpatient Drug and Alcohol Rehab in Hockessin, Delaware

Today, different in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ation facilities vary regarding the outline and execution of their drug and alcohol addiction treatment treatment plans and services. For example, the duration of time you will spend participating in therapy and detox will vary from one program to another. Whereas some facilities last as long as nine months or more, others will be short and take about 30 days.

In the same way, these programs in Hockessin vary in terms of the level of autonomy and freedom you will have while participating in addiction rehab. Some of the centers are locked down, where clients won't be able to leave the center as you address your alcohol and drug abuse and any co-occurring mental health issues. In such a center, you may not even be have access to the internet or be allowed visitors. Other facilities, however, may allow you some leeway to associate with the world outside while still focusing on full recovery.

When you choose inpatient drug rehabilitation, therefore, it is essential that you examine various programs and choose the one that best suits your needs. Some of the factors you should consider include:

a) Monetary Policies

Ask the residential center whether they accept insurance, offer financial support, and have a variety of payment choices.

b) Offerings and Services

You should also research and find out what the Hockessin, DE. rehabilitation facility has to offer regarding accommodation, food, recreation, therapy, and other aspects of drug addiction rehab.

As you continue looking into different inpatient alcohol and drug rehab centers, keep in mind that no given facility will be effective for every addict. To this end, it might be in your best interests to closely examine what every facility can offer until you get to a facility that is best suited to meet your requirements and preferences.

Overall, inp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ation is among the most effective of all types of drug addiction treatment protocols. The time you spend in one of these centers will ensure that you can productively focus on your recovery without the temptations and triggers that you may encounter if you select outpatient treatment.
